It was working fine just

Check your fuses and make sure one didn't blow. Also, re-check power at the back of the unit to make sure you have 12V on the battery/memory wire(yellow) and the switch power wire(red). The battery wire is always hot and the red should have power once you turn on the key.

Color code for panasonic model cq5301u [wiring

okay here it is

on all aftermarket radio they follow a color code

iginition 12 volts red
constant 12 volts yellow
ground black
remote wire amp turn on blue/white stripe


speakers
Lfront + white
Lfront - white/black stripe

Rfront +gray
Rfront _gray/black stripe

Lrear +green
Lrear -green/black stripe

Rrear + purple
Rrear - purple/black stripe

some radio have other wires too
like dimmer wire orange
power anntenna blue



and some flip screen radio have parking brake wire green

Rear wiring connection/wiring

red= (switched)power+ black is ground = connect to metal surface yellow is memory needs battery+ at all times white/whiteblack is front left speaker grey/greyblack is right front speaker green/green black is left rear speaker violet/violetblack is rear right speaker

Panasonic CQ-FN46E0GX No Sound

Hi Greg, I'd say you have a bad audio output IC, generally this will take out the fusable resistor that feeds the output stage, you should be able to find a part number on the IC, do a pin out and check between B+ and ground pins with it in circuit and see if you see a short. Panasonic SA-AK87 stereo system. After switching on CD ejecting. Reset problem. Set hangs on on CD. After that not switching to another source?

Question edited for clarity and typos. The first thing with CD Ejection issues is to try a CD Cleaning Disc. It has brushes to clean the laser optics. They always fail on the low power tracking laser. When it fails self test, it ejects. also First unplug power for at least an hour, then press and hold the power/on button while plugging back in, and keep holding for another 60 seconds .
